Understanding the Shifts in Digital Media Consumption
Recent data indicates that over 73% of global internet traffic now originates from mobile devices, emphasizing the importance of mobile-first strategies (UK Digital Report, 2023). Moreover, platforms like TikTok and Instagram have rewritten engagement norms, shifting audiences towards more visual and short-form content. Traditional content models can no longer suffice; instead, strategies must incorporate dynamic, adaptable frameworks that resonate with contemporary consumption habits.
Principles of a Robust Digital Content Strategy
- Audience-Centric Planning: Deep understanding of target demographics through behavioural data.
- Content Personalisation: Leveraging AI-driven analytics to tailor experiences.
- Omnichannel Integration: Ensuring brand consistency across platforms to maximise engagement.
- Quality over Quantity: Prioritising authoritative, well-researched content that fosters trust.
The Role of Data in Strategy Development
Implementing data-driven insights enables content creators to identify what truly resonates with their audience. Advanced analytics reveal valuable patterns—most notably, the preferences for interactive content formats, shorter headlines, and multimedia embellishments. Understanding these nuances facilitates the crafting of more engaging and shareable content, reinforcing brand authority and credibility.
Emerging Technologies Shaping Content Strategies
| Technology | Impact | Industry Example |
|---|---|---|
| Artificial Intelligence | Automates content curation, personalisation, and SEO optimization. | AI tools like MarketMuse enhancing content planning and relevance |
| Augmented Reality (AR) | Creates immersive experiences, boosting user engagement and retention. | L’Oréal’s AR makeup try-on features in digital campaigns |
| Blockchain | Provides transparency and security, crucial for digital rights management. | Emerging decentralised content monetisation models |
